A more efficient solution, where encapsulation is done after all data 
has been read from database:

diff --git a/src/lib/dhcpsrv/pgsql_host_data_source.cc 
b/src/lib/dhcpsrv/pgsql_host_data_source.cc
index a1251be692..5c438aac17 100644
--- a/src/lib/dhcpsrv/pgsql_host_data_source.cc
+++ b/src/lib/dhcpsrv/pgsql_host_data_source.cc
@@ -2530,6 +2530,11 @@ 
PgSqlHostDataSourceImpl::getHostCollection(PgSqlHostContextPtr& ctx,
                        << tagged_statements[stindex].name);
          }
      }
+
+    for (auto& host : result) {
+        
boost::const_pointer_cast<Host>(host)->getCfgOption4()->encapsulate();
+        
boost::const_pointer_cast<Host>(host)->getCfgOption6()->encapsulate();
+    }
  }

  ConstHostPtr

Of course, this is just for postgresql.

>> You would need to load the cb_cmds hook to manage the option-def and
>> option-data in the database
>> (https://kea.readthedocs.io/en/kea-2.2.0/arm/hooks.html#cb-cmds-configuration-backend-commands)
>> using the API commands.  You also need to connect to the database for
>> configuration backend
>> (https://kea.readthedocs.io/en/kea-2.2.0/arm/dhcp4-srv.html#configuration-backend-in-dhcpv4)
>> so that it can load the configuration containing the options from the
>> database for use.
>> 
>> I saw neither of these things in your config file.
